What Are Fiber Frames, Panels & Enclosures?

Fiber frames, panels, and enclosures are essential components used to terminate, organize, splice, and distribute optical fibers within a network infrastructure.

They provide a structured environment for fiber connections, helping technicians manage cables efficiently while protecting sensitive optical components from physical damage and environmental factors.

Common applications include:

  • Data center fiber distribution
  • Telecom central offices
  • FTTx networks
  • Enterprise structured cabling
  • Industrial communication systems

Types of Fiber Frames, Panels & Enclosures

Fiber Panels

Fiber panels are designed to provide a centralized location for fiber termination and patching.

They allow easy access to fiber adapters, connectors, and splice modules while maintaining proper cable organization.

Key Features:

  • High-density fiber management
  • Modular design for flexible expansion
  • Support for multiple connector types
  • Easy installation and maintenance

Fiber panels are widely used in data centers, server rooms, and telecom environments where efficient fiber management is required.

Fiber Enclosures

Fiber enclosures provide protection and organization for fiber optic connections, splice trays, and adapter modules.

They are available in different configurations, including rack-mounted, wall-mounted, and outdoor solutions.

Advantages:

  • Protect fiber connections from damage
  • Improve cable routing and organization
  • Support various fiber configurations
  • Enable future network expansion

Fiber enclosures are essential for maintaining stable and reliable optical connections.

Optical Distribution Frames (ODF)

Optical Distribution Frames (ODF) are large-scale fiber management systems commonly used in telecom networks and data centers.

An ODF provides a complete solution for:

  • Fiber termination
  • Fiber splicing
  • Optical distribution
  • Cable management
  • Network protection

With high-density capacity and modular structures, ODF systems simplify the management of large fiber networks.
